COSTERISAN v. DeLONG

Docket No. 709.

251 Cal.App.2d 768 (1967)

59 Cal. Rptr. 803

H.H. COSTERISAN et al., Plaintiffs and Appellants, v. DONALD M. DeLONG, as Executor, etc., Defendant and Respondent.

Court of Appeals of California, Fifth District.

June 13, 1967.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Vizzard, Baker, Sullivan & McFarland and Allan H. McFarland for Plaintiffs and Appellants.

Hahn & Hahn and Loren H. Russel for Defendant and Respondent.


STONE, J.

Plaintiffs appeal from an adverse judgment in an action to recover a balance due for a number of deliveries of hay. The complaint alleges two common count causes of action, an open book account and an account stated.
